WebStrophic form is most commonly seen in popular music, folk music, or music that is verse based. This is because the material is repeated so much. Each of those A’s represents a short verse, normally 8 to 16 measures long. It’s also common to see strophic form represented in blues music, chants, and in some instances of Classical music. Web8 Mar 2024 · Whole Note (Semibreve) The first note is called a semibreve, or in the US, it’s called a ‘ whole note .’. It’s like a small oval-shaped zero or letter O, which is a good way to think of it when you first begin writing music. We call this oval-shaped part of a note ‘ the note head ’. A semibreve has a value of four beats.
